Oracle數(shù)據(jù)庫的基礎(chǔ)使用涉及安裝、配置、創(chuàng)建用戶、表、執(zhí)行查詢和修改數(shù)據(jù)等操作。以下是關(guān)于Oracle數(shù)據(jù)庫各方面的詳細(xì)解析:
1、Oracle數(shù)據(jù)庫簡介
定義與作用:Oracle數(shù)據(jù)庫是Oracle公司開發(fā)的一款關(guān)系型數(shù)據(jù)庫管理系統(tǒng)(RDBMS),廣泛用于企業(yè)級(jí)應(yīng)用程序中,支持多用戶、高并發(fā)、分布式等復(fù)雜場(chǎng)景。
2、安裝與配置
獲取安裝包:需要從Oracle官方網(wǎng)站下載對(duì)應(yīng)操作系統(tǒng)的安裝包,并根據(jù)提示完成安裝流程。
檢查服務(wù):安裝后在Windows服務(wù)管理器中查找名為"OracleService"的服務(wù),確認(rèn)其運(yùn)行狀態(tài)。
連接數(shù)據(jù)庫:使用SQL*Plus工具或Oracle SQL Developer等客戶端工具連接到數(shù)據(jù)庫。
3、基本概念理解
表(Table):是存儲(chǔ)數(shù)據(jù)的最基本單元,類似于Excel表格,由多個(gè)字段(Column)組成。
記錄(Row):表中的一行數(shù)據(jù)即為一條記錄,包含所有列的信息。
SQL語言:用于與Oracle數(shù)據(jù)庫交互的主要語言,包括查詢(SELECT)、插入(INSERT)、更新(UPDATE)、刪除(DELETE)等操作。
4、用戶管理
默認(rèn)系統(tǒng)用戶:Oracle安裝后會(huì)生成sys、system、sysman、scott等默認(rèn)用戶,其中sys擁有最高權(quán)限,而scott通常被鎖定供學(xué)習(xí)使用。
解鎖用戶:如要使用被鎖定的scott用戶,需先以system用戶登錄并解鎖。
5、創(chuàng)建與管理表空間和用戶
創(chuàng)建表空間:在Oracle中可以通過SQL語句創(chuàng)建永久表空間和臨時(shí)表空間,用以存儲(chǔ)不同類型的數(shù)據(jù)。
創(chuàng)建用戶:為不同的使用者創(chuàng)建獨(dú)立的用戶,并通過權(quán)限控制來確保數(shù)據(jù)安全。
6、數(shù)據(jù)操作
插入數(shù)據(jù):使用INSERT INTO語句將數(shù)據(jù)插入到已創(chuàng)建的表中。
查詢數(shù)據(jù):通過SELECT語句檢索表中的數(shù)據(jù),可以結(jié)合WHERE子句指定條件。
更新數(shù)據(jù):如果需要修改表中的數(shù)據(jù),可以使用UPDATE語句。
刪除數(shù)據(jù):使用DELETE語句可以根據(jù)條件從表中移除數(shù)據(jù)。
總的來說,Oracle數(shù)據(jù)庫的強(qiáng)大之處在于其可靠性、高性能以及豐富的功能,但同時(shí)也要求使用者具備一定的數(shù)據(jù)庫知識(shí)和技能。初學(xué)者在熟悉了上述基礎(chǔ)操作之后,還需要通過不斷的實(shí)踐和深入學(xué)習(xí),才能充分發(fā)揮Oracle數(shù)據(jù)庫的潛力。